Common questions
How many calories are in Risotto Milanese Style With Saffron?
Risotto Milanese Style With Saffron by Alessi has 321 kcal per 100 g. One serving (56 g) is about 180 kcal.
How much protein is in Risotto Milanese Style With Saffron?
Risotto Milanese Style With Saffron contains 7.1 g of protein per 100 g — about 4 g per 56 g serving.
Is Risotto Milanese Style With Saffron high in carbs?
Yes — carbohydrates provide 91% of its calories (75 g per 100 g, of which 1.8 g is sugar). It also delivers 3.6 g of fiber.
Is Risotto Milanese Style With Saffron low in sugar?
Yes — only 1.8 g of sugar per 100 g. Most of its 75 g of carbs come from starch and fiber rather than sugar.
Is Risotto Milanese Style With Saffron high in sodium?
Yes — 1267.9 mg of sodium per 100 g, about 55% of the daily value.
Is Risotto Milanese Style With Saffron a good source of fiber?
It provides 3.6 g of fiber per 100 g — 13% of the daily value.
Why does Risotto Milanese Style With Saffron have a Nutri-Score of C?
Nutri-Score weighs negatives (calories, sugar, saturated fat, sodium) against positives (fiber, protein) per 100 g. Points against come from sodium (1267.9 mg); points in favor come from fiber (3.6 g). Overall that places it in band C.
How much Risotto Milanese Style With Saffron is 100 calories?
About 31 g of Risotto Milanese Style With Saffron equals 100 kcal. It is energy-dense, so small amounts add up quickly.
